Essential Requirements
To take the driving license test in Australia, there are several essential requirements that must be met. These include obtaining a learner permit and logging specific hours of driving experience. The minimum age for obtaining a learner permit varies by state but is commonly 16 years. Candidates must complete at least 120 hours of logged driving under supervision to qualify for the test, which is a requirement in most states. Meeting these criteria is critical in ensuring that you have the necessary skills and experience to handle the responsibilities of driving.
Necessary Documents and Permits
Before sitting for the driving test, you will need to prepare several important documents and permits. These documents typically include:
- Learner Permit: This is mandatory and indicates that you are authorized to practice driving.
- Proof of Identity: A valid form of identification must be presented, which can be a passport or other government-issued ID.
- Logbook: This document records all your driving hours and should be filled out accurately.
Having these documents ready will streamline the process on test day and reduce any unnecessary stress.
Licensing Criteria and Learner Permit Rules
The licensing criteria for learner permit holders in Australia encompass various rules and regulations intended to promote road safety. It’s essential to adhere to the following key points:
- Supervised Driving Requirement: Learner drivers must always be accompanied by a supervisor who holds a valid driver’s license.
- Use of Logbook: All driving hours must be documented in the logbook, detailing the times, dates, and driving conditions experienced.
- Test Day Criteria: On the day of the test, you must present your learner permit, logbook, and necessary identification.
These rules are designed not only to ensure that you have the necessary practice but also to prepare you for safe driving after obtaining your license.
Effective Study Methods
Preparing for the driving test entails more than just practice behind the wheel. Employing effective study methods can greatly enhance your understanding of road rules and increase your likelihood of success. Here are several strategies:
- Familiarize with Road Rules: Regularly review the Road Safety Handbook provided by your state or territory to ensure a solid understanding of traffic signs, road markings, and laws.
- Conduct Mock Tests: Practice established test scenarios with a qualified instructor or a licensed supervisor to build confidence.
- Use Online Resources: Leverage available online quizzes and materials that cover the essential aspects of the driving test.
Implementing these study methods is instrumental in ensuring not only mastery over theoretical knowledge but practical application as well.

Tips to Successfully Pass the Exam
Achieving success on your driving test requires preparation and the right mindset. Here are several tips designed to help increase your chances of passing:
- Stay Calm: Nervousness can affect performance, so practice relaxation techniques to remain composed during the test.
- Follow Examiner Instructions: Always pay close attention to the examiner’s directions, confirming understanding when necessary.
- Demonstrate Safe Driving Practices: Consistently show that you are aware of road safety rules, making safe decisions during your driving test.
Incorporating these tips into your preparation will not only assist in passing the test but could also make you a safer driver in the long run.
